Mediterranean turkey-stuffed peppers

6 steps
Prep:10minCook:25min
Can be frozen! Try not to overcook the peppers as they will collapse and lose their shape. Freeze the mince separately then just defrost, reheat and fill peppers with hot mince.

Instructions

Step 1
Preheat oven to 200°C (fan 180°C, gas mark 6).
Step 2
Rub the peppers with a little coconut oil, place on a baking tray and cook in the oven for 20 minutes.
Step 3
For stuffing: In a medium-sized frying pan over a medium heat add the remaining coconut oil and gently fry the onions for 2-3 minutes.
Step 4
Add the mushrooms, garlic and cumin cook for a further 2-3 minutes.
Step 5
Add the ground turkey, chopped tomatoes, tomato paste, soy sauce and oregano. Mix well in the pan and simmer for 10 minutes.
Step 6
Fill the peppers with the stuffing and top with the cheese. Flash under the broiler to melt cheese and serve with the greens of your choice.
